Use Oura Ring data to support patient care
Providers
Oura Ring is available on Fullscript, allowing you to include wearable devices alongside your supplement plans and view patient health data in one place.
When a patient connects their Oura Ring, you can review insights such as sleep, activity, stress, and recovery directly in their profile. This data helps you understand patient habits between visits and supports your clinical decision-making.
Add Oura Ring to a plan
You can include Oura Ring in supplement plans, protocols, or collections so patients can purchase it through Fullscript.
Patients can access the device from your recommendations or directly through the catalog. Including Oura Ring in a plan helps patients follow your guidance and stay engaged between visits.
View wearable data in the patient profile
When a patient connects their Oura Ring, their data syncs to their profile.
Once connected, you can:
- Review sleep, activity, stress, and recovery data
- Track trends over time
- Identify changes in patient habits

What to keep in mind
- Wearable data is one input—use it alongside your clinical judgment
- Patients must connect their device to share data
- Not all patients may choose to connect a device
- Available metrics may vary based on device settings and usage
